What is defiance meaning?

defiance can be defined as a repeated, deliberate violation of authority. If an individual acts in a way that goes against what their parents or teachers have told them is the right way to behave, it is clear that they are demonstrating defiance. Children typically show defiance when they challenge authority even when they do not understand the consequences of their actions.
